/// Parsed result from Thunderbird-style autoconfig XML or DNS SRV fallback.
|
|
#[derive(Debug, Clone, Default, PartialEq, Eq)]
|
|
pub struct MailConfig {
|
|
pub incoming: Vec<IncomingServer>,
|
|
pub outgoing: Vec<OutgoingServer>,
|
|
}
|
|
|
|
#[derive(Debug, Clone, Default, PartialEq, Eq, Deserialize)]
|
|
pub struct IncomingServer {
|
|
#[serde(rename = "@type")]
|
|
pub protocol: String,
|
|
pub hostname: String,
|
|
#[serde(default)]
|
|
pub port: u16,
|
|
#[serde(rename = "socketType")]
|
|
pub socket_type: String,
|
|
pub username: String,
|
|
}
|
|
|
|
#[derive(Debug, Clone, Default, PartialEq, Eq, Deserialize)]
|
|
pub struct OutgoingServer {
|
|
#[serde(rename = "@type")]
|
|
pub protocol: String,
|
|
pub hostname: String,
|
|
#[serde(default)]
|
|
pub port: u16,
|
|
#[serde(rename = "socketType")]
|
|
pub socket_type: String,
|
|
pub username: String,
|
|
}
|
|
|
|
// ---------------------------------------------------------------------------
|
|
// Internal XML wrapper structs matching the Thunderbird config-v1.1 schema:
|
|
// <clientConfig> → <emailProvider> → <incomingServer> / <outgoingServer>
|
|
// ---------------------------------------------------------------------------
|
|
|
|
#[derive(Debug, Deserialize)]
|
|
#[serde(rename = "clientConfig")]
|
|
struct ClientConfig {
|
|
#[serde(rename = "emailProvider", default)]
|
|
email_providers: Vec<EmailProvider>,
|
|
}
|
|
|
|
#[derive(Debug, Deserialize)]
|
|
struct EmailProvider {
|
|
#[serde(rename = "incomingServer", default)]
|
|
incoming_servers: Vec<IncomingServer>,
|
|
#[serde(rename = "outgoingServer", default)]
|
|
outgoing_servers: Vec<OutgoingServer>,
|
|
}
|
|
|
|
/// Parse Thunderbird autoconfig XML into a `MailConfig`.
|
|
/// Exposed for unit testing.
|
|
pub(crate) fn parse_autoconfig_xml(xml: &str) -> Option<MailConfig> {
|
|
let client_config: ClientConfig = from_str(xml).ok()?;
|
|
let provider = client_config.email_providers.into_iter().next()?;
|
|
Some(MailConfig {
|
|
incoming: provider.incoming_servers,
|
|
outgoing: provider.outgoing_servers,
|
|
})
|
|
}
|
|
|
|
// ---------------------------------------------------------------------------
|
|
// Network helpers
|
|
// ---------------------------------------------------------------------------
|
|
|
|
async fn fetch_xml(client: &Client, url: &str) -> Option<MailConfig> {
|
|
let resp = client.get(url).send().await.ok()?;
|
|
if !resp.status().is_success() {
|
|
return None;
|
|
}
|
|
let text = resp.text().await.ok()?;
|
|
parse_autoconfig_xml(&text)
|
|
}

async fn lookup_srv(domain: &str) -> Option<MailConfig> {
|
|
let resolver = TokioResolver::builder(TokioConnectionProvider::default())
|
|
.ok()?
|
|
.build();
|
|
|
|
let imap_srv = format!("_imaps._tcp.{}.", domain);
|
|
let imap_lookup = resolver.lookup(imap_srv, RecordType::SRV).await.ok()?;
|
|
let imap_record = imap_lookup.iter().next()?;
|
|
let (imap_host, imap_port) = match imap_record {
|
|
RData::SRV(srv) => {
|
|
let host = srv.target().to_string().trim_end_matches('.').to_string();
|
|
(host, srv.port())
|
|
}
|
|
_ => return None,
|
|
};
|
|
|
|
let smtp_srv = format!("_submission._tcp.{}.", domain);
|
|
let smtp_lookup = resolver.lookup(smtp_srv, RecordType::SRV).await.ok()?;
|
|
let smtp_record = smtp_lookup.iter().next()?;
|
|
let (smtp_host, smtp_port) = match smtp_record {
|
|
RData::SRV(srv) => {
|
|
let host = srv.target().to_string().trim_end_matches('.').to_string();
|
|
(host, srv.port())
|
|
}
|
|
_ => return None,
|
|
};
|
|
|
|
Some(MailConfig {
|
|
incoming: vec![IncomingServer {
|
|
protocol: "imap".to_string(),
|
|
hostname: imap_host,
|
|
port: imap_port,
|
|
socket_type: "SSL".to_string(),
|
|
username: "%EMAILADDRESS%".to_string(),
|
|
}],
|
|
outgoing: vec![OutgoingServer {
|
|
protocol: "smtp".to_string(),
|
|
hostname: smtp_host,
|
|
port: smtp_port,
|
|
socket_type: "STARTTLS".to_string(),
|
|
username: "%EMAILADDRESS%".to_string(),
|
|
}],
|
|
})
|
|
}

/// Discover mail server configuration for a domain using the Thunderbird
|
|
/// autoconfig protocol (ISPDB) and DNS SRV fallback.
|
|
///
|
|
/// Probe order:
|
|
/// 1. `https://autoconfig.{domain}/mail/config-v1.1.xml`
|
|
/// 2. `https://{domain}/.well-known/autoconfig/mail/config-v1.1.xml`
|
|
/// 3. DNS SRV records (`_imaps._tcp` / `_submission._tcp`)
|
|
/// 4. Thunderbird central ISPDB (`https://autoconfig.thunderbird.net/v1.1/{domain}`)
|
|
pub async fn fetch(domain: &str) -> BichonResult<MailConfig> {
|
|
let client = Client::builder()
|
|
.timeout(std::time::Duration::from_secs(10))
|
|
.build()
|
|
.map_err(|e| raise_error!(format!("{:#?}", e), ErrorCode::InternalError))?;
|
|
|
|
// 1. Try autoconfig subdomain
|
|
if let Some(config) = fetch_xml(
|
|
&client,
|
|
&format!("https://autoconfig.{domain}/mail/config-v1.1.xml"),
|
|
)
|
|
.await
|
|
{
|
|
return Ok(config);
|
|
}
|
|
|
|
// 2. Try well-known path
|
|
if let Some(config) = fetch_xml(
|
|
&client,
|
|
&format!("https://{domain}/.well-known/autoconfig/mail/config-v1.1.xml"),
|
|
)
|
|
.await
|
|
{
|
|
return Ok(config);
|
|
}
|
|
|
|
// 3. Try DNS SRV records
|
|
if let Some(config) = lookup_srv(domain).await {
|
|
return Ok(config);
|
|
}
|
|
|
|
// 4. Fall back to Thunderbird central database
|
|
if let Some(config) = fetch_xml(
|
|
&client,
|
|
&format!("https://autoconfig.thunderbird.net/v1.1/{domain}"),
|
|
)
|
|
.await
|
|
{
|
|
return Ok(config);
|
|
}
|
|
|
|
Err(raise_error!(
|
|
format!("No autoconfig found for domain: {domain}"),
|
|
ErrorCode::InternalError
|
|
))
|
|
}
